The global disinfectors market size was USD 3780.4 million in 2021 and is projected to touch USD 11795 million by 2031, exhibiting a CAGR of 11.9% during the forecast period.

RESTRAINING FACTORS
"Several Challenges Associated with the Local Irritation to Restrain the Market"
The disinfector market is facing a number of restraining factors, including stringent regulatory requirements, high cost of raw materials, competition from generic brands, counterfeit products, consumer awareness, and alternative technologies. These factors could slow down the growth of the market in the coming years. Stringent regulatory requirements are leading to higher costs for manufacturers, as they are required to make their products more effective and have a longer shelf life. The high cost of raw materials is also a restraining factor, as the cost of alcohol and chlorine has been rising in recent years. Competition from generic brands is also a challenge, as these brands are often cheaper than name-brand disinfectants. Counterfeit products are a growing problem, as they are often not effective and can pose a health risk to consumers. Consumer awareness of the potential health risks of disinfectants is also increasing, which could lead to a decrease in demand for these products. Finally, alternative technologies, such as ultraviolet light and ozone gas, are becoming more effective and affordable, which could lead to a decrease in demand for disinfectants.

KEY INDUSTRY PLAYERS
"Financial Players to Contribute Towards Expansion of Market"
The disinfectants market is dominated by a few key players, including Reckitt Benckiser, Ecolab, 3M, and Procter & Gamble. These companies have a strong brand presence and a wide range of products. They are also investing heavily in research and development to develop new and innovative disinfectant products. Other key players in the market include Kimberly-Clark, Diversey, Clorox, and Zep. These companies are also well-established and have a strong presence in the market. They are also investing in new product development and are expanding their product offerings. The disinfectants market is a dynamic market, and new players are entering the market all the time. However, the key industry players are likely to remain dominant in the coming years.
